SuSE comes with a program called "gramofile" which is a non-graphical LP-ripping program with user-configrable surface noise reduction filters, and other nifty features. I use this, along with "sweep" (very good wave editor program) to convert LPs to CDs and MP3s. I think gramofile should also be perfectly usable for cassette tape ripping. -Ti -- Ti Kan http://www.amb.org/ti Vorsprung durch Technik
